Location ^
Kincorth is an established residential area of town which boasts a number of social/leisure facilities including a community centre offering activities for all age groups, churches, doctor's surgery and a swimming pool and within easy commuting distance to the Industrial Estates to Altens and Tullos. Education is provided by Abbottswell Primary and Kincorth Academy. Regular public transport allows access to the city centre and many other areas of town.
